#defeb2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#defeb2 is composed of 87.1% red, 99.6%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 85.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 84.7%. #defeb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bdfd65.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#defeb2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#defeb2 has RGB values of R:222, G:254,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0. Its decimal value is 14614194.

Hex triplet defeb2 #defeb2
RGB Decimal 222, 254, 178 rgb(222,254,178)
RGB Percent 87.1, 99.6, 69.8 rgb(87.1%,99.6%,69.8%)
CMYK 13, 0, 30, 0
HSL 85.3°, 97.4, 84.7 hsl(85.3,97.4%,84.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 85.3°, 29.9, 99.6
Web Safe ccff99 #ccff99
CIE-LAB 95.842, -22.932, 33.031
XYZ 73.6, 89.627, 55.539
xyY 0.336, 0.41, 89.627
CIE-LCH 95.842, 40.211, 124.771
CIE-LUV 95.842, -15.019, 50.72
Hunter-Lab 94.671, -26.905, 31.487
Binary 11011110, 11111110, 10110010

Shades and Tints of #defeb2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7ff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#defeb2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d8dad6 is the less saturated color, while #defeb2 is the most saturated one.
